Originally Posted by RonG617
Does anyone pay full price for digital comics? I would love to use the subscription feature on Comixology, but only if they offered a discount for doing so. I can get the print version through dcb and other services for 25 to 50% off, I can't understand why I couldn't get the same deal on a digital version.
Because B&M comic stores would revolt. DCBS and other online services are basically using volume and a thinner margin to give you discounts that local stores won't match, but at least at this point the ordering process is too onerous (ie: Previews) for a casual buyer. But if Marvel and DC did instant subscriber digital discounts through comixology... Stores already complained when they went day to date (really, I think you can get most stuff at the stroke of midnight, earlier than B&Ms open) and the dollar discount you get on most DC comics after a month.
